Cromwell Valley Park Home School Garden Club
March 26, 2010 - May 21, 2010
Homeschool Garden Club. Cromwell Valley Park (near Towson) is offering a 5 session gardening class for homeschoolers (ages 10-18)on alternate Friday mornings: Mar. 26, April 9, Apr. 23, May 7, May 21. Cost: $20 for members; $25 for non-members. Registration required. Call 410-887-2503. How does your garden grow? You\'ll learn how in this hands-on class on the basics of vegetable and native plant gardening from the ground up. Raise your own cool-weather crops and earn service learning hours in our adopt-a-garden program.

Southern Maryland Homeschool Band
Music. Music. Southern Maryland Homeschool Band and Recorder Group Lessons will be starting this Fall. There will be 2 bands depending on the experience of the child, and will be taught to children 9 years old and up (4th grade and up) or at the discretion of the director. Beginning Band (children with little or no experience on a band instrument), and Advanced Band, Instruments include Flute, Clarinet, Saxophone, French Horn, Trumpet, Trombone, Baritone, Tuba, and Percussion/Drums). There will also be Beginning Recorder group lessons for school-aged children (5 or 6 year olds too if they are good readers) - Wednesday afternoons beginning Sept. 10 at St. Paul's Episcopal Church in Waldorf for this also. St. Timothy's Homeschool Umbrella Program
St. Timothy's Home School Umbrella Program is an educational ministry of St. Timothy's Church in Catonsville, Maryland. We are an approved home school oversight umbrella of the Maryland State Department of Education. Our primary purpose is to support, assist, advise and encourage parents in their role as educators of their children in grades K-12.
